Jessica Simpson on Tony: ‘I Love This Guy’

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

Time flies when you’re in love, Jessica Simpson has discovered. Though her relationship with Dallas Cowboys quarterback Tony Romo only has been cooking since around last Thanksgiving, “It feels like forever,” Simpson, 27, tells Glamour magazine for its June issue. “I love this guy. Can you feel it?”. Crediting Romo, 28, with helping her rediscover her inner strength, “What he’s done for me is irreplaceable,” she says. “He reintroduced me to myself. I thought that I had to be deeper, more profound and more artsy. … Tony taught me that because he loves me [as me]. He made me feel comfortable [being myself] again.

On the topic of her ex-husband, Nick Lachey, she says, “There’s too much competition [with a musician],” while of John Mayer, with whom she was linked on and off for nine months (he recently was spotted in Miami with Jennifer Aniston), she says, “You change with the guys you date. [I thought] I had to be more intellectual.”

She tells of meeting Romo after she heard on TV that he had a crush on her – and she thought he was “really cute.” They eventually flirted over e-mail and the phone, then set up their first date for Nov. 20, when her entire family went to see Romo play.

Their First Kiss
When they finally ended up in the hotel restaurant, “He goes like this across the table,” says Simpson, demonstrating how Romo puckered up. “I go, ‘What are you doing?’ He goes, ‘Nothing,’ and starts pouting. I said, ‘Were you just trying to kiss me in front of all these people?’ He goes, ‘Maybe.’ I’m like, ‘Try it again.’ ”

Looking back, she says, “The fact that this guy, on our first date, in the first 10 minutes of dinner, wanted to lean over the table and say, This is my girl and I want to kiss her – our first kiss in front of everybody – was awesome.”

Hilary Duff Dishes on Avril, Lindsay and Miley

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

Hilary Duff may have been in show business for a decade, but she’s never gotten used to tangling with her fellow celebutantes. “It’s hard to find people who don’t feel like they’re in competition with you,” she tellsHilary Duff Dishes on Avril, Lindsay and Miley Allure in its May issue. But while Duff, 20, may try to stay out of the fray, she can’t help but chat – a little, anyway – about some of her peers. She dishes to Allure about Lindsay Lohan, Miley Cyrus and Avril Lavigne:

• On Lindsay Lohan: “Supposedly, I stole Lindsay Lohan’s boyfriend [Aaron Carter.] We were, like, 13! And I’ve never stolen anyone’s boyfriend! I don’t know how you do that! . . . She was talking about it and I wasn’t. It made us both look bad and put up a big weirdness. Really she was just a girl my age. We are fine now, by the way.”

• On Miley Cyrus: “We don’t have each other’s phone numbers. But when she meets me, she’s excited. It’s cute – I see a lot of myself in her.”

• On Avril Lavigne: “I said something about how she didn’t like her fans dressing like her, and how she should appreciate that because it’s a compliment. She called me a goody-goody [Lavigne called Duff a 'mommy's girl' in Newsweek] Everyone is trying to prove who they are, and their position. So, I’m ‘the good girl.’ She’s ‘the bad girl’ or ‘the party girl.’ Sarah Jessica Parker doesn’t take her clothes off, but she’s not a ‘good girl.’ [Adult actors] don’t get tagged like we do.”

Karina Smirnoff Denies Breaking Up With Mario Lopez

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

Dancing With the Stars pro Karina Smirnoff denies she has split from Mario Lopez. “We’re going on strong,”Karina Smirnoff Denies Breaking Up With Mario Lopez she told PEOPLE on Tuesday. “As much as I love and appreciate the attention, this isn’t true.” She adds: “For the record, I am not moving out. Everything is great.” In her production trailer was a bouquet of roses. “These roses are from (Lopez) and they certainly are not a farewell gift,” she says.

The pair, who met during Dancing’s third season, never publicly acknowledged their relationship — until now — despite the fact that they were living together in Lopez’s Los Angeles home.

A source had said Smirnoff was moving out of Lopez’s digs. Smirnoff also was spotted recently with E! Entertainment personality Michael Yo. The two were seen dancing at a recent event at Hollywood eatery Beso.

“Michael and I have known each for a long time, and there’s nothing romantic whatsoever,” Smirnoff says. “He’s a great guy and I really respect him, but we’re just friends.”

Jennifer Garner Laughs Off Baby Question

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

Jennifer Garner appreciates her fans – even when they ask the tough questions. Asked, “When are you going to have another [child]?” during a break in filming This Side of Truth last Friday, the 36-year-old actress laughed off the unexpected query. “Sometime,” she replied. “I don’t know. I have to think about that one.”

Garner – who was in Lowell, Mass., shooting the flick (costarring Tina Fey and Ricky Gervais) – made sure to spend quality time with fans of all ages. But she paid special attention to her youngest admirers.

“I have to say hi to the girls,” she said, heading over to sign autographs for a crowd. She made sure all the children got some face time.

Ben Affleck’s other half asked one little girl, “Are you a swimmer?” before revealing, “I was a swimmer when I was your age.”

Other young fans asked about daughter Violet, 2. “She’s good,” replied Garner, who fended off compliments about her appearance with some good-natured modesty. She joked to one admirer: “That’s what five hours of hair and makeup will do for you!”

Cameron’s Letter to Fans

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

Cameron Diaz skipped a press junket for her new film, “What Happens in Vegas,” Saturday, and instead sent a handwritten letter. Ashton Kutcher delivered the note from Cam, whose father died less than two weeks ago from pneumonia.”First of all, I want to thank all of you for your support over the years,” Diaz wrote. “So many films, so many weekends discussing films. I was really looking forward to this weekend getting to talk to my friends about a film that I am so proud of.

“Due to the loss of my father, I have chosen to be with my family this weekend. But it was important for me to convey to all of you how much I love this film. We really did have the best time, and the most fun and laughs making it. I know that the stories Ashton, Rob [Corddry] and [Director] Tom [Vaughan] share with you will illustrate that point. I was fortunate to work with a group of truly gifted individuals that share the common denominator of a generous heart and wickedly sick sense of humor.”

The letter continues, “This weekend I am screening “What Happens in Vegas” for my family. It was a unanimous decision that we all needed to share a good laugh. After all, that’s why we make films like these. So people can leave behind their worries for a couple of hours. Have a good laugh.

I picture all of your smiles and it makes me happy.

Thank you for your continued support. It is much appreciated.”

Paula’s ‘Idol’ Confusion

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

It was a hectic night on “American Idol,” with the final five each crooning two Neil Diamond songs. Instead of the usual format, in which the judges critique each hopeful after their performance, Randy, Paula and Simon were asked to take notes during performances and offer their opinions at the end of each round. The new format threw off Paula Abdul — she critiqued both songs from Jason Castro — even though he had only sung one! “The second song, I felt like your usual charm wasn’t — it was missing for me. It kind of left me a little empty,” says Abdul, “the two songs made me feel like you’re not fighting hard enough to get into the top four.”

Randy Jackson cleared up the confusion by reminding Paula that Castro had only sung once. Even judge Simon Cowell, who had his usual harsh critiques for the aspiring Idols, admitted that the new format had also thrown him for a loop. “This was officially the strangest show we’ve ever done,” Cowell said at the end of the show, “but I like that. It’s kind of a bit chaotic tonight.”

Paula Zahn blew her fortune, sez hubby Richard Cohen

Posted on 30 April 2008 by JoyCeleb

The scourned husband of former CNN anchor Paula Zahn says there’s no way he could have mismanaged her millions because she was spending the money as fast as she made it. Less than two weeks after being sued by Zahn for making “dubious investments” with more than $25 million, her jilted hubby, Richard Cohen, fired back by branding his estranged wife a wastrel who wants to air their dirty laundry in public.

Paula Zahn blew her fortune, sez hubby Richard Cohen“The $20 million cost of her Connecticut mansion alone (without even including the extravagant nature of Ms. Zahn’s annual expenditures) consumed more than her entire income over their 20-year marriage,” Cohen’s lawyer, Douglas Flaum, charged in court papers filed in Manhattan Supreme Court.

A source close to Cohen, 59, added that Zahn, who recently lost her anchor job at CNN, spent “wild” money on clothes, even as the network gave her a healthy clothing allowance.

Flaum argued that Cohen, a real estate mogul, couldn’t answer Zahn’s charges that he made “dubious investments” because “her earnings were spent elsewhere.”

The legal volley fired by Cohen, whom the 51-year-old Zahn dumped for a steamy affair with multimillionaire Paul Fribourg, upped the ugliness in the couple’s public split after two decades of marriage.

Divorce papers have yet to be filed, and Cohen charged that Zahn’s suit, filed late on Aug. 24, was nothing more than a sneak attack to smear him in the press - even after months of “highly sensitive” settlement talks between the warring spouses.

“Ms. Zahn has gone to great lengths to conceal the true nature of the action: a marital dispute that should be heard, if at all, in a matrimonial proceeding,” Flaum wrote.

If the suit was as calculated as Cohen contends, the ploy may have backfired when the Daily News revealed days later that Zahn had a “love book” that documented her romance with Fribourg, the married CEO of ContiGroup.

Cohen discovered the lurid volume with the couple’s 17-year-old daughter, one of their three kids.

“It’s a shame that her lawyer launched this untrue lawsuit,” a Cohen friend said. “It’s created a bigger mess.”

Zahn’s lawyer, Stanley Arkin, did not return calls. Zahn could not be reached for comment.

In the suit, Zahn charged that Cohen wasn’t being forthcoming with her demands for an accounting of what he did with more than $25 million of the TV news reader’s fortune. It also accused the megabucks developer of diverting some of Zahn’s earnings into his own account.

Cohen, the founder of Boston-based Capital Properties, contends in court papers that Zahn would rather make flashy purchases than investments.

Cohen’s image previously took a pounding when he served as president of a co-op board that in 2004 evicted red-tailed hawks Pale Male and Lola from their fancy Fifth Ave. perch.

Zahn’s nasty fight with her soon-to-be ex-husband comes on the heels of her split from CNN, which once hyped her as “just a little bit sexy” to the sound of a zipper being unzipped.
